The next Blonde Bash will be held on the weekend of 18th/19th of March at Cincinnati's in Glasgow

The provisional programme of events is as follows:


Friday 17th

* Normal £20 Cincinnati comp, open to public

Saturday 18th

* Club open from 1pm for meeting/greeting/drinking/Sit N Goes
* 7pm £30 Double Chance Freezeout. Maximum runners 100
* Through the night: SNG/Cash/Heads Up Comp

Sunday 19th

* 1pm Sunday lunch and Quiz at the club
* 4pm £20 competition at Hamilton Academicals FC with Celebrity Poker players from the footballing world. Shuttle transport provided from Cincinnatis.
* Regular £20 competition open to public in the evening for those still standing.



You will note the the maximum tournament capacity at Cincins is 100. However, not being bound by gaming commission rules we will operate a system of alternates. For those unfamiliar with this, it works as follows:

The first 100 names on the Acceptances thread shortly to be started on the Live Poker board will get a seat in the double chance comp. The rest go on the reserve list. As players get knocked out of the comp for the first two hours only they are replaced by players from the reserve list in order. Last time Tikay lasted three hands in a double chance comp. Whilst he might beat that this time, don't bank on it so if you are high on the rerserve list you have every chance of getting in.
